Can proxy IP testing detect DNS leaks?

Author:PYPROXY
2025-02-02

DNS (Domain Name System) leaks are a major privacy concern for internet users, especially when utilizing proxy servers or Virtual Private Networks (VPNs). These leaks can expose the user’s browsing activities and location, compromising the anonymity and security these services are supposed to offer. One of the commonly asked questions is whether testing a proxy ip can help detect DNS leak issues. Proxy servers are designed to mask users' IP addresses, but this doesn't automatically protect against DNS leaks. Testing a proxy IP for DNS leaks involves analyzing whether DNS queries are being sent outside the proxy server’s encrypted tunnel. In this article, we will explore whether proxy IP testing can effectively detect such leaks, as well as what steps can be taken to mitigate these risks.

Understanding DNS Leaks and Proxy Servers

Before diving into whether proxy IP testing can detect DNS leaks, it’s important to first understand what DNS leaks are and how proxy servers work.

What is a DNS Leak?

DNS leaks occur when DNS queries are sent outside the encrypted tunnel of a VPN or proxy server. This means that even if the user’s internet traffic is being routed through a secure connection, their DNS requests can still be routed through their local internet service provider (ISP), revealing their browsing history and location. This can defeat the purpose of using a VPN or proxy to maintain privacy.

How Proxy Servers Work

A proxy server acts as an intermediary between the user’s device and the internet. It can mask the user’s IP address and route their internet traffic through a different server, effectively hiding the user’s true location. However, not all proxy servers route DNS requests through their own servers. This can lead to DNS leaks if the queries are sent to the ISP’s DNS servers, which can track and log the user’s browsing activity.

Can Proxy IP Testing Detect DNS Leaks?

What Proxy IP Testing Reveals

Proxy IP testing primarily focuses on determining whether a user's real IP address is exposed during their browsing session. While this test can confirm whether the proxy is effectively masking the user's real IP, it doesn’t necessarily provide a direct indication of DNS leaks. DNS leaks are a separate issue that occurs when DNS queries are handled outside the proxy’s secure tunnel. Therefore, while proxy IP testing can confirm that the user is using a proxy and hide their actual IP, it does not test the route that DNS queries take.

Why Proxy IP Testing Is Limited

Proxy IP testing typically involves checking the IP address exposed by the user when accessing a website. However, DNS queries are often made by the device or application itself before the proxy takes over the routing of the traffic. If the DNS queries bypass the proxy and reach the ISP directly, this could result in a DNS leak without affecting the proxy IP test.

While proxy IP tests can confirm that the user’s IP address is masked, they won’t reveal whether the DNS queries are leaking to an external source. Therefore, DNS leaks cannot be reliably detected by proxy IP testing alone.

How DNS Leaks Can Be Detected

DNS Leak Testing Tools

To detect DNS leaks, users need to perform specialized DNS leak tests, which are designed to identify if any DNS queries are being sent outside the encrypted tunnel. These tests can reveal whether the DNS queries are being handled by the user’s ISP, which would indicate a DNS leak. There are various online tools and websites that can check for DNS leaks by analyzing the DNS servers being used during an internet session. If the test shows that the queries are being sent to a third-party DNS provider instead of the proxy server’s DNS, it confirms the existence of a DNS leak.

Steps to Prevent DNS Leaks

Users can take several steps to mitigate DNS leaks and enhance their privacy:

1. Use a Proxy with DNS Leak Protection: Some proxy services offer built-in DNS leak protection that ensures DNS queries are routed through their secure servers. This prevents the queries from reaching the ISP's DNS servers.

2. Use DNS Servers That Are Managed by the Proxy: Users should ensure that the proxy or VPN service they are using routes DNS requests through its own servers. This ensures that the DNS queries are encrypted and do not leak outside the secure tunnel.

3. Manually Configure DNS Settings: For more control over DNS requests, users can manually configure their DNS settings to use a privacy-focused DNS server. This prevents the use of default ISP DNS servers and reduces the chances of DNS leaks.

4. Regular DNS Leak Tests: Users should periodically test for DNS leaks to ensure their proxy or VPN is functioning correctly and that their DNS queries are not leaking.

The Role of Proxy Servers in DNS Leak Prevention

Proxy servers can play a key role in preventing DNS leaks, but only if they are configured to handle DNS queries securely. Many proxies do not automatically route DNS requests through their servers, which can leave users vulnerable to leaks. It is essential for users to choose proxy services that offer DNS leak protection or manually configure their system to route DNS requests securely.

How Proxy Servers Can Help

When a proxy service routes both internet traffic and DNS queries through its own servers, it prevents the DNS requests from bypassing the secure tunnel and leaking to external servers. This ensures that both the user’s IP address and DNS queries remain hidden, providing full anonymity.

Why DNS Leak Protection Is Crucial

For users who value their privacy and security, DNS leak protection is crucial. Even if the proxy successfully masks the user’s IP address, a DNS leak can still expose their browsing activities, negating the benefits of using a proxy. Effective DNS leak protection ensures that all aspects of the user’s internet activity remain private, preventing external parties from tracking or logging their online behavior.

Conclusion

In conclusion, while proxy IP testing is useful for checking whether a user’s real IP address is hidden, it cannot reliably detect DNS leaks. DNS leaks require a specific test that analyzes the route of DNS queries and whether they are being sent outside the secure tunnel. Users concerned about DNS leaks should look for proxy or VPN services with built-in DNS leak protection or manually configure their DNS settings to ensure their privacy is maintained. Regular DNS leak tests are essential for identifying and preventing these leaks, helping users maintain their security and anonymity online.
